About Early Childhood Center

Early Childhood Center is a public school in West Liberty, IA, part of West Liberty Comm School District. Early Childhood Center serves approximately 71 students, and covers grades Pre-K-Pre-K, and has a 14.2:1 student-teacher ratio. Early Childhood Center has a current MySchoolScout rating of 4.4 out of 10 and ranks #1,099 of 1,280 schools in IA.

What Parents Should Know

At 71 students, Early Childhood Center is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.

Early Childhood Center s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.
